In 2020-2021, 648 people earned their degree in dispute resolution, making the major the 296th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, dispute resolution gra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$50,878 and had an average of $0 in loans still to pay off.
Across Missouri, there were 36 dispute resolution graduates with average earnings and debt of $51,372 and $0 respectively.
